Luo Council of Elders appeal for a peaceful mourning following Raila's death

Nyandiko Ongadi (carrying a fly whisk), one of the elders who has laid claim to the position of chairman of the Luo Council of Elders, with other elders when they addressed journalists at his home in Kendu Bay on Thursday, June 29, 2023. [File, Standard].

Members of the Luo Council of Elders have called for peace even as the nation mourns the death of ODM leader and former Prime Minister Raila Odinga.

Speaking at the Council's offices at the Ofafa Memorial Hall in Kisumu, the elders, led by their Chairman Odungi Randa, called on the community members to unite and peacefully honour the legacy of the fallen political giant.
